Yes, a bearded dragon can absolutely get too much UVB. While UVB is crucial for their health and well-being, providing an excessive amount can lead to significant health issues.
The Dangers of Excessive UVB Exposure
UVB radiation is essential for bearded dragons as it enables them to synthesize Vitamin D3, which is vital for calcium absorption and metabolism. Without adequate UVB, bearded dragons can develop serious conditions like Metabolic Bone Disease (MBD). However, the balance is delicate, and overexposure carries its own risks:
- UVB Burns: Similar to sunburns in humans, prolonged exposure to overly intense UVB can cause skin irritation, redness, blistering, and discomfort.
- Eye Damage: Excessive UVB can lead to conditions like photokeratoconjunctivitis (inflammation of the cornea and conjunctiva) and cataracts, which can impair vision and cause pain.
- Stress and Behavioral Changes: A bearded dragon constantly exposed to overwhelming UVB light may become stressed, lethargic, or hide excessively to escape the intensity, indicating discomfort.
Tailoring UVB for Your Bearded Dragon
The "right" amount of UVB is not a universal standard. It depends on several factors, including the specific type of UVB bulb, its distance from the basking spot, and importantly, the individual bearded dragon's needs and morph.
Special Considerations for Sensitive Morphs
Certain bearded dragon morphs (genetic variations) are particularly susceptible to UVB overexposure due to reduced pigmentation or lack of scales. These include:
- Hypomelanistic: Morphs with significantly reduced dark pigmentation.
- Translucent: Morphs with skin that appears more transparent, often lacking an opaque layer.
- Scaleless (Silkback): Morphs that entirely lack scales, making their skin highly exposed.
These specific morphs are likely to be more sensitive to high quantities of UVB. For their safety, they may need a lower-strength UVB bulb, and their basking area should be exposed to a UV Index (UVI) of no more than 3.0. Careful monitoring is essential for these dragons to prevent adverse reactions.
Ensuring Optimal UVB Levels
To provide your bearded dragon with the correct amount of UVB and prevent overexposure, follow these practical guidelines:
- Select the Correct Bulb Strength: Choose a UVB bulb (e.g., linear fluorescent tube or mercury vapor bulb) that is appropriate for your enclosure size and the general needs of bearded dragons. For most standard bearded dragons, the UVI in the basking area should typically range between 3.0 and 7.0, creating a gradient across the enclosure. Always ensure the bulb's output aligns with recommended levels for bearded dragons.
- Maintain Proper Distance: The effective range of UVB bulbs varies significantly by brand and type. Always follow the manufacturer's recommendations for the correct mounting distance between the bulb and your bearded dragon's basking spot. Using a UV meter (solarmeter) is highly recommended to accurately measure the UV Index at different points within the enclosure, ensuring safe levels.
- Create a UVB Gradient: Design your enclosure to have a basking area with optimal UVB and a cooler side with lower UVB exposure. This allows your bearded dragon to self-regulate its UV exposure, moving between areas as needed.
- Replace Bulbs Regularly: UVB output degrades over time, even if the bulb continues to emit visible light. Fluorescent tube UVB bulbs typically need replacement every 6-12 months, while mercury vapor bulbs usually last 12-18 months. Always adhere to the manufacturer's recommended replacement schedule.
- Observe Your Dragon: Pay close attention to your bearded dragon's behavior. Signs of discomfort, such as frequent squinting, excessive hiding from the light, or changes in skin appearance, could indicate that the UVB levels are too high.
